Concert Chorus
6th - 8th Grades
The Concert Chorus welcomes students in 6th to 8th grades and serves as our premier treble ensemble that tackles the most challenging treble compositions among our chorus groups. Singers are tackling more intricate harmonies through multi-part music.
​
Distinguished for their exceptional musicality, artistic expression, and unwavering discipline, Concert Chorus members frequently receive invitations to participate in special concerts and events. They proudly represent our chorus in the community and embody a high standard of professionalism.
More About Our Concert Chorus Program

Singers learn more advanced note and rhythm reading, musical symbols identification, and sight singing.

Concert Chorus members work to master and perform music that is technically and musically challenging and requires highly developed skills in reading music, part singing, independence, responsibility for individual practice, and vocal maturity. All of which enables them to complete their training towards membership in the Chamber Singers Program.
